One Step Beyond: Redefining Photography in the Digital Age at Galerie Christophe Gaillard

exhibition · 2026-04-24

From September 6 to 20, 2014, Galerie Christophe Gaillard hosts the group exhibition 'One Step Beyond,' curated by Christophe Gaillard and Isabelle Le Minh. This exhibition showcases artists who question conventional photography in the digital age. Among the works is Le Minh's 'L'Autre de l'Art (Rosalind Krauss)' (2013), which critiques Krauss's index-based theory. It aims to redefine photography and includes contributions from artists such as Constance Nouvel and Hannah Whitaker. The exhibition highlights the lack of attention from French institutions, aside from the Centre Photographique d'Île-de-France. Additionally, significant international exhibitions like 'What is a Photograph?' at ICP in New York and 'Under Construction' at Foam in Amsterdam feature Kate Steciw. Letha Wilson's solo exhibition is scheduled from October 9 to November 15, 2014.
